Common Concrete Driveway Repair Jobs
Crack Repair - filling and sealing cracks to prevent further damage and deterioration.
Surface Leveling - addressing uneven or sunken areas for a smooth, safe driveway surface.
Resurfacing - applying a new layer of concrete to restore appearance and durability.
Expansion Joint Repair - fixing or replacing joints to accommodate concrete movement and prevent cracking.
Stain and Discoloration Removal - cleaning and restoring the driveway’s original appearance.
Full Driveway Replacement - removing and replacing damaged concrete for a long-lasting solution.
Concrete Driveway Repair Questions
What types of damage can be repaired on a concrete driveway? Common issues include cracks, surface spalling, and uneven settling that can be addressed to restore appearance and functionality.
How is a concrete driveway repair typically performed? Repairs often involve crack sealing, surface patching, or leveling to improve stability and prevent further damage.
Can a damaged driveway be resurfaced instead of replaced? Yes, resurfacing can be a practical option to improve the look and durability without full replacement.
What signs indicate that a driveway needs repair?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, and pooling water are signs that repairs may be necessary to maintain safety and integrity.
